The Samsung Galaxy S25 series launch has been preceded by leaked promotional materials showcasing One UI 7’s AI capabilities and key specifications.

Core hardware and release details: The Galaxy S25 lineup, consisting of three models, will feature Qualcomm’s new Snapdragon 8 Elite SoC and is set to launch on January 22, 2025.

  • The series includes the standard S25, S25+, and S25 Ultra models
  • The new devices represent incremental hardware improvements over their predecessors

AI-powered features in One UI 7: Samsung’s latest operating system update emphasizes artificial intelligence capabilities across multiple functions.

  • Galaxy Insights provides contextual summaries including morning briefs, evening briefs, and commute summaries by aggregating data from installed apps
  • Initial integration appears limited to Samsung’s proprietary apps, with broader app support expected in future updates
  • The AI features are powered by the new Snapdragon 8 Elite processor, designed to handle complex AI tasks

Camera enhancements: The S25 series introduces new AI-powered photography and video capabilities to address previous limitations.

  • Night Video feature, similar to Google Pixel‘s low-light capabilities, improves visibility in dark environments
  • Audio Eraser functionality has been integrated into the camera app
  • ProScaler, a new screen feature exclusive to QHD+ devices, aims to enhance visual display quality on the AMOLED panel

Additional features and connectivity: Samsung continues to expand its ecosystem and messaging capabilities.

  • The device includes familiar features like Samsung Wallet and Smart Switch
  • RCS messaging is prominently featured, potentially targeting iPhone users considering a switch to Android
  • The company maintains focus on ecosystem integration and cross-device functionality

Looking ahead: While the hardware improvements appear modest, Samsung’s emphasis on AI integration suggests a strategic shift toward software-based differentiation in the competitive smartphone market. The success of features like Galaxy Insights and ProScaler could establish new benchmarks for AI implementation in mobile devices.
